Bay Manzano Resort, Villa La Angostura
Located in his own bay about Nahuel Huapi, Bahía Manzano Resort gives dream postcards: the still lake like an icy mirror, pines that dawn with flakes in their cups and mountains that hold the sky. It offers aparts and cabins for two to eight people, each equipped with kitchen, dining room, large windows and wood decks to breathe the southern air.
The resort has a restaurant where the Patagonian cuisine is expressed with trout, deer and lamb in author versions. The experience is completed with heated swimming pools, a complete spa with sauna, disorder and massage rooms; Gym to not abandon routine and a playroom with games for all ages, ideal for families looking for nature and comfort in equal extent.
Wyndham Garden Ushuaia Hotel del Glacier, Ushuaia
At the end of the world, where the mountain range rushes to the sea, the Wyndham Garden Ushuaia rises in full nature reserve El Martial. Its 122 rooms, suites and loft offer views that cover from the Beagle Canal to the glaciers and mountains that watch silent. It is a hotel designed for those who want to absorb immensity and then recover in a shelter of contemporary warmth.

Its Restaurant Temaukel pays tribute to Patagonian gastronomy with lamb, centolla and Fuegian flavors, marked with a careful selection of Argentine wines. The Kayen Bar is ideal to close the day with infusions, tapas and the white winter postcard through infinite windows. The hotel excursion team organizes every day so that no guest repeats landscape: Trekking for the Esmeralda lagoon, 4×4 crossings by glacier valleys, navigations to the lighthouse of the end of the world or contact with marine wolves in the Beagle Canal.

During the winter, its Ski Week and Mini Ski Week packages include transfers and passes to Cerro Castor, the most southern ski ski center on the planet, with rental of equipment and classes. For the adventurers, he proposes walks with snow rates, jackets in motorcycles and sleds in the Las Cotorras valley. All this is completed with the warm attention of your staff and the privilege of awakening in the confine of the continent to begin, every day, a new expedition.
Llao Llao Hotel & Resort, Bariloche
More than a hotel, Llao Llao is a symbol. Its architecture of red tiles and noble wood melts with the Barilochese landscape, as if it had always been there. Lakes such as Nahuel Huapi and Moreno, eternal forests and snowy peaks are admired from their studios and suites.

Among its services are its indoor/outdoor heated semi -olimatized pool, an 18 holes golf field surrounded by mountains, a high -level spa with relaxation and beauty therapies, activities for children and adults, and restaurants that exalt regional gastronomy with international delicacy. Llao Llao not only offers lodging: he gives a way of living Patagonia with the solemnity of a temple and the warmth of a home.
Pire Hue Ski Hotel, Cerro Cathedral
Nestled at the foot of the cathedral, Pire Hue Ski Hotel is an alpine refuge in the purest essence of the word. From its rooms, dawn looks out on white slopes and the day begins with the distant whistle of the aerosillas.

The hotel offers direct access to the slopes and means of lifting, ski school for those who take their first steps in the snow, equipment rental, ski room, heated pool, jacuzzi, spa with dry and humid sauna, gym, and a restaurant with panoramic views where to enjoy a mountain stew or a hot chocolate after a day in the snow. Its atmosphere combines wood, stone and warm details that invite deep rest.
THE HAYAS RESORT HOTEL, Ushuaia
In the southernmost city in the world, beechs rises on the slope of a forest that looks at the Beagle Canal and Martial glaciers, melting green, white and blue in the same symphony. Its 93 rooms – from upper double to luxury suites with hydromassage – maintain a refined rustic style, with wood and soft tones that enhance the outer view.

The hotel offers a complete spa with dry and humid sauna, a disrepair shower, heated pool for adults and children, gym and a program of activities such as yoga, streetching and guided walks to the glacier. Its Gourmet restaurant exalts the Fuegian gastronomy with sentolla, black hake and lamb, while its English style pub offers author cocktails in a warm and elegant environment. For the little ones, there are game rooms and recreation activities, making you a true family palace in the confine of the continent.
The Ski & Summer Lodge shelter, San Martín de los Andes
Located in the Ski Village slopes, minutes from the Chapelco hill, this Lodge proposes a concept of mountain vila with 42 cabin units, each equipped with complete kitchen, dishes, microwave, chrown with freezer, electric shelf, electric pava, television, safety box and a cozy additional sofa sofa. The most exclusive include salamandra for reading afternoons in front of the fire.

The complex has a swimming pool, gym, Wi-Fi connection throughout the property and common spaces designed for rest and socialization after the ski day. Its location offers views on Lake Lacar, El Chapelco and the city of San Martín de los Andes, combining loneliness, community and extreme beauty.
Villa Labrador, Bariloche
If Bariloche is synonymous with winter magic, Villa Labrador is its most intimate and pure version. This nine -hectare premium complex extends on the shore of Lake Moreno, with eternal views to López and Goye hills. His seven cabins –maitén, Alerce, Cohiue, Ciprés, Lenga, Alamos and the Majestual Araucaria– have been designed to fuse nature and comfort in the same hug.

Each cabin offers complete kitchen, white clothes, towels, radiant slab heating and firewood, in addition to grid with firewood and decks with uninterrupted views to the lake and snowy mountains. The complex has a place for children, soccer field, ecological path, lake coast with a private beach and, in summer, outdoor heated pool. The Araucaria cabin, with its 600 m² and capacity for 18 people, is a luxury and warmth microcosm, designed for families and large groups that wish to share without sacrificing intimacy or their own spaces. Villa Labrador is not just a lodging: it is the place where winter becomes eternal memory.
